University of Arizona: Newly Discovered Protein Could Be Used To Produce Life-Saving Antifungals

University of Arizona researchers have discovered a protein that is responsible for controlling cell growth in yeasts. Since humans and yeasts have remarkably similar cellular mechanisms, teasing out the differences presents drug developers with new targets for treatments.
